#4858d1 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4858d1 is composed of 28.2% red, 34.5% green and 82%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 65.6% cyan, 57.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 18% black. It has a hue angle of 233 degrees, a saturation of 59.8% and a lightness of 55.1%. #4858d1 color hex could be obtained by blending #90b0ff with #0000a3. Closest websafe color is: #3366cc.

Shades and Tints of #4858d1
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010205 is the darkest color, while #f4f5fc is the lightest one.

Tones of #4858d1
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#868793 is the less saturated color, while #1c36fd is the most saturated one.
